This blue commemorative plaque records: On this site stood Golfhall Built 1717 The World's First Golf Clubhouse later called Foxton, Golf House Tavern, Golf Hotel used by Royal Burgess, Bruntsfield Links, Bruntsfield Allied, Edinburgh Thistle, Bruntsfield Short Hole and other golf clubs.
